Clarence "Clem" Hartman, 84, of Canal Fulton, died, Saturday, November 20, 2010. Clem was born in Doylestown and had been a longtime resident of Canal Fulton. He was an Army veteran of World War II, retired from Ohio Litho, Akron and was a member of SS. Philip & James Catholic Church. He enjoyed hunting, fishing and trips to Canada. He was preceded in death by his wife, Vivian; special friend, JoAnn F. Bauer; brothers, Joseph and Leo; sisters, Celia and Margaret; and parents, Joseph and Mary. He is survived by sons, Thomas (Maria) Hartman of Akron, Larry (Sandy) Hartman of Orlando, Florida; daughter, Linda Swiat of Homerville; grandchildren, Adam, Samantha, Lee, Rebecca, Daniel and Amy; numerous great-grandchildren. A Memorial Mass will be held SATURDAY, 10 a.m. at SS. Philip & James Catholic Church, 412 High St. N., Canal Fulton, with Fr. John Warner officiating. Burial with Military Honors by VFW #9795 at Canal Fulton Union Cemetery. Memorials may be made to the American Diabetes Association.
